Output 676980ed39232ea37cab765c8cd51af3c6e66962d316c5969f95fe6e5d1eaf5b:9

value
502467
script pubkey
OP_0 OP_PUSHBYTES_20 17e905e2b1bb4cecf3db80fcc2722189bc1ef320
address
bc1qzl5stc43hdxweu7msr7vyu3p3x7paueqz3n8r8
transaction
676980ed39232ea37cab765c8cd51af3c6e66962d316c5969f95fe6e5d1eaf5b